**Finance Review Summary — Tarnbeck Proposal**

Branch managers: our finance group has completed its initial review of the possible acquisition of Tarnbeck Logistics. Revenue quality is acceptable, debt load is higher than first modeled, and integration costs for the Wexhall depots remain uncertain. Orin Calder's team recommends proceeding to extended diligence with strict conditions. Further detail follows at the regional meeting. The confidential note on business plans appears below.

board note of kageg-bahof: The renewal with Holwynax Holdings closes at $2 million a year, 5 percent below the last contract. Project Ulaath slips by two quarters because of the supplier delay.

INTERNAL MEMO — Inventory Write-Down, Marlow Instruments

To the incoming director: please review the following carefully. In March we recorded a write-down covering obsolete Helix-series calibration rigs held at the Brandell facility, approximately 11% of that site's book value. The decision followed two independent condition assessments and sign-off from group finance. All supporting schedules are archived and reconciled. You should be aware of one confidential consideration, stated below.

management briefing: Jorixax Holdings is in early talks to buy Casixax Holdings for about $420.3 million. The Fenmir launch date is October 27, and nothing goes to the press before then. Legal wants the Keloxek Foods term sheet redrafted before April 16.

## Formula sandbox tuning

User-supplied formulas in Gridmoor execute inside a restricted interpreter with hard ceilings on time, memory, and call depth. Reviewers should confirm any change to these ceilings is justified in the PR description, since raising them widens the abuse surface. Defaults were chosen from production traces. The current limits are as follows.

limits module of tafog-fawip:
WEIGHTS = {
    "julix": 57,
    "lamys": 992,
    "kasvan": 209,
    "quenok": 750,
    "alddor": 259,
    "oliath": 1009,
    "wenix": 815,
}